#OnThisDay in 1909, the @NAACP (National Association for the Advancement of Colored People) was founded by an interracial group including W.E.B. Du Bois, Ida B. Wells, Mary White Ovington, and Moorfield Storey. #BlackHistoryMonth#APeoplesJourney#ANationsStory

#OTD in 1862 Abraham Lincoln almost visited @MountVernon. The steamer he was aboard, Mount Washington, docked and Lincoln was advised to remain in the boat. It seems he heeded this advice. Photo: courtesy of the Library of Congress.

Today is Lunar New Year, which begins the Year of the Dragon 🐉
This Chinese vase (26.262), on view in the dining room, is known as a meiping and features two leaping five-clawed dragons.
